Barcelona relies on Dani Olmo’s patience to sign him in 2024

Dani

Barcelona target Dani Olmo’s contract with RB Leipzig expires in 2024, making him a fascinating option this summer. The 25-year-old offensive midfielder is currently available at a reasonable price. While the German team is still hesitant to lose him, other elite clubs are taking notice of his situation.

Barcelona can sign Dani Olmo in 2024

Spanish news outlet Diario AS claims that, while Barcelona are actively considering him, their stance is slightly different. Bayern Munich and Real Madrid have also shown interest in signing him this summer. But Barcelona wants him to wait another season. This is because the team has yet to respond to the Financial FairPlay rules, and their compliance with La Liga’s salary cap is also off. Because they can’t afford to contract him this summer, they’re doing everything they can to get him for free in 2024.

Many teams saw him as a pure bargain because to his growing experience in the UEFA Champions League as well as representing his national team, Spain, at European Championships and the FIFA World Cup. While Leipzig has yet to place a price tag on him, it is anticipated that a cost of between €30 million and €40 million would be sufficient to lure him away. Leipzig’s position has remained consistent up until the time of writing i.e. they do not want to lose him. However, when the market approaches, they may be pushed to explore all available possibilities.

Barcelona, on the other hand, cannot afford to pay a transfer fee to sign him in the summer, leaving them fully reliant on the player’s wishes. He has not yet renewed his contract with Leipzig, and it appears doubtful that he will. This suggests the player will leave either this summer or in 2024.
